What Force is needed to give a 3.5m/s^2 acceleration to 1200 kg car

Respuesta :

reallysweettea reallysweettea
  • 17-03-2022

Answer:

4200N

Explanation:

Force = acceleration × mass

f=3.5×1200

f=4200
